    What Does a Cardiovascular Ultrasound Tech Do, Exactly?

    So, what does a Cardiovascular Ultrasound Tech actually do? Well, in a nutshell, they are medical imaging specialists. They use ultrasound equipment to create images of the heart and blood vessels. These images, called echocardiograms, help doctors diagnose and monitor a variety of cardiovascular conditions. Think of it like this: they are the eyes of the cardiologist, providing a detailed, non-invasive view of the heart's inner workings. The job involves a blend of technical skill, patient care, and a good dose of problem-solving. It's not just about pushing buttons; it's about understanding anatomy, physiology, and how to get the best possible images to help with diagnoses. We will break down the main responsibilities, so that you get a clear view of what you might be doing day to day.

    • Operating Ultrasound Equipment: This is the core of the job. Technicians expertly handle ultrasound machines, adjusting settings to get the clearest images possible. They need to understand the technology inside and out. It's like being a skilled photographer but for the inside of the human body. They will use the machine, position the patient correctly, and manipulate the ultrasound probe to capture detailed images of the heart and blood vessels. This involves a lot of precision and knowledge of how sound waves work. It is crucial to be able to know how to adjust the machine and to optimize the images. Because, in the end, it is those images that doctors are using to make a diagnosis and come up with a treatment plan.
    • Preparing Patients: Before the imaging begins, the technician will explain the procedure to the patient and make them feel comfortable. This could involve answering questions, ensuring the patient is in the correct position, and applying gel to the skin to help with the sound waves' transmission. This part of the job is all about patient interaction. This will also involve helping them relax. This is an important skill to make patients feel comfortable and at ease during what can be a stressful time.
    • Analyzing Images: After acquiring the images, the technician reviews them to ensure they are of high quality and that all the necessary views have been obtained. It is very important to get good images to help the doctors make a good diagnosis. While techs don't make the final diagnosis (that's for the doctors), they play a vital role in identifying any abnormalities and ensuring the images are suitable for interpretation.
    • Assisting Physicians: Cardiovascular Ultrasound Techs often work closely with cardiologists and other physicians, providing real-time imaging during procedures like stress tests and cardiac catheterizations. They are an integral part of the healthcare team. They may also assist doctors during specialized procedures, providing valuable real-time imaging to guide interventions.
    • Maintaining Equipment and Records: They are also responsible for keeping the ultrasound equipment in good working order and maintaining detailed patient records. This includes routine maintenance, troubleshooting minor issues, and ensuring everything is clean and properly calibrated. They're also responsible for maintaining accurate patient records.

    The Education and Training Path

    Okay, so you are interested in becoming a Cardiovascular Ultrasound Tech? Awesome! But how do you get there? The path typically involves a combination of education, training, and certification. Let's break down the key steps:

    • Educational Programs: The first step is to complete an accredited educational program in cardiovascular technology or a related field. There are a few pathways you can take here. The most common is to earn an Associate of Applied Science (AAS) degree in cardiovascular technology. These programs typically take about two years to complete and include classroom instruction, lab work, and clinical rotations. For those looking for a bit more, some universities offer a Bachelor of Science (BS) degree in cardiovascular technology. These programs provide a broader educational experience and may open doors to leadership roles. Then, there's also the option of a certificate program, which can be a good option for those who already have a degree in a related field, like radiography or diagnostic medical sonography. These programs focus specifically on cardiovascular ultrasound. Always make sure that the program you choose is accredited by organizations like the Commission on Accreditation of Allied Health Education Programs (CAAHEP). This accreditation ensures that the program meets certain standards of quality and prepares you well for the profession.
    • Clinical Rotations: A significant part of your education will involve clinical rotations. This is where you get hands-on experience in a real-world healthcare setting. During rotations, you'll work under the supervision of experienced cardiovascular ultrasound techs, practicing your skills and learning how to interact with patients. You'll gain practical experience in operating ultrasound equipment, preparing patients, and assisting physicians. These rotations are an invaluable opportunity to apply what you've learned in the classroom and develop your clinical skills.
    • Certification: After completing your educational program, the next step is to obtain certification. Certification is a voluntary process, but it's highly recommended, as it demonstrates your competence and professionalism. The most common certifications are offered by organizations like Cardiovascular Credentialing International (CCI) and the American Registry for Diagnostic Medical Sonography (ARDMS). To become certified, you'll need to pass an examination that tests your knowledge and skills in cardiovascular ultrasound. These exams cover a wide range of topics, including anatomy, physiology, ultrasound physics, and various cardiovascular pathologies. Certification not only boosts your career prospects but also assures employers and patients that you meet the required standards of practice.

    Skills Needed to Succeed

    Being a Cardiovascular Ultrasound Tech is more than just knowing how to operate equipment. It requires a specific set of skills to excel in this field and provide the best possible care. Here's what you'll need:

    • Technical Proficiency: You'll need a strong understanding of ultrasound technology and how it works. This includes knowing how to adjust the equipment settings to get the best images, understanding the principles of sound wave propagation, and troubleshooting equipment issues. You'll need to develop excellent hand-eye coordination and the ability to work with precision. The ability to quickly and accurately identify anatomical structures on the ultrasound images is crucial. This requires a strong foundation in anatomy and physiology, as well as the ability to recognize normal and abnormal findings.
    • Anatomy and Physiology Knowledge: A solid understanding of human anatomy and physiology, especially the cardiovascular system, is essential. You'll need to know the structure and function of the heart, blood vessels, and other related organs. You'll also need to understand how diseases and conditions affect the cardiovascular system and how to identify these abnormalities on ultrasound images. Familiarity with medical terminology is also crucial, as you'll be using and interpreting medical reports.
    • Patient Care Skills: Cardiovascular Ultrasound Techs interact with patients daily, so good communication and interpersonal skills are a must. This includes the ability to explain procedures clearly, answer patient questions, and make patients feel comfortable and at ease. You'll need to be patient, empathetic, and able to work with people of all ages and backgrounds. Dealing with patients can sometimes be challenging, especially when they are scared or in pain. Developing your ability to manage stress and stay calm in challenging situations is very important.
    • Critical Thinking and Problem-Solving: The ability to think critically and solve problems is essential. You'll need to be able to analyze images, identify potential issues, and troubleshoot equipment malfunctions. Cardiovascular Ultrasound Techs must also adapt to unexpected situations and make quick decisions, especially during emergencies or when performing procedures. It's important to develop your ability to assess situations, evaluate different options, and make informed decisions.
    • Communication Skills: Clear and effective communication skills are important for several reasons. You'll need to communicate clearly with patients, explaining the procedure and answering their questions. You'll also need to communicate effectively with physicians and other healthcare professionals, providing accurate and timely information. You'll be working with a diverse team of healthcare professionals. It's crucial to be able to collaborate effectively, share information, and work together toward the common goal of providing the best possible patient care.

    Salary and Job Outlook

    Alright, let's talk about the money and the job prospects! As a Cardiovascular Ultrasound Tech, you can expect a competitive salary and a positive job outlook. The demand for qualified professionals in this field is growing, so there are plenty of opportunities out there.

    • Salary Expectations: According to the U.S. Bureau of Labor Statistics, the median annual salary for diagnostic medical sonographers, including cardiovascular ultrasound techs, was around $81,350 in May 2023. Of course, the exact salary can vary based on several factors, including your experience, education, location, and the type of employer. Entry-level positions typically start at a lower salary, while experienced techs with advanced certifications or specialized skills can earn significantly more. Working in major metropolitan areas, where the cost of living is higher, can also lead to a higher salary. Always remember that the salary is just one part of the job. Also consider things such as benefits, such as health insurance, retirement plans, and paid time off. These can be valuable parts of your overall compensation.
    • Job Outlook: The job outlook for cardiovascular ultrasound techs is very promising. The U.S. Bureau of Labor Statistics projects a growth rate of 10% for diagnostic medical sonographers between 2022 and 2032. This is faster than the average for all occupations. This growth is driven by several factors, including the aging population, the increasing prevalence of cardiovascular diseases, and the growing demand for non-invasive diagnostic imaging techniques. The increasing demand for cardiovascular ultrasound services means more job opportunities for qualified techs. More jobs mean more choices for you, so you can tailor your career to your ideal settings. The demand for cardiovascular ultrasound services is expected to continue to increase. This growth is good news for those interested in entering this field. If you’re looking for a stable career with good opportunities, this may be a good option for you.

    Where Can You Work?

    So, where do Cardiovascular Ultrasound Techs actually work? There are various places where these professionals can put their skills to use. This variety can allow you to select a work environment that matches your preferences and lifestyle.

    • Hospitals: Hospitals are the most common employers. Here, you'll be working alongside cardiologists, radiologists, and other healthcare professionals, providing imaging services for a wide range of patients. You'll be working in a fast-paced environment and dealing with complex cases.
    • Outpatient Clinics and Diagnostic Centers: Many cardiovascular ultrasound techs work in outpatient clinics and diagnostic centers, which offer specialized imaging services. These facilities often provide a more focused work environment and may offer more flexible hours.
    • Physician's Offices: Some cardiologists and other physicians have their own ultrasound equipment and employ techs to perform imaging services in their offices. This can offer a more intimate work environment and a closer working relationship with the physician.
    • Mobile Ultrasound Services: Some techs work for mobile ultrasound services, traveling to various locations, such as nursing homes or other healthcare facilities, to provide imaging services. This can be a great option if you enjoy variety and like to travel.
